  2. Metrics for Engagement • There is no doubt that essential markers of web pages these days are valuable for ranking and this is because of the development of Google Search algorithms. On the other side, traffic engagement is measured by pages per session, and it is the average number of pages viewed in a single session. • Quicker ranks are facilitated by bigger numbers, which indicate more active audiences. Positive engagement is further reinforced by scroll depth, which measures how far down a page users scroll, and time spent on a page, which speeds up the ranking process. • Unique Visitors • One of the most important metrics is the number of unique visitors or unique people visiting a website. Increases in unique visits are a sign of popularity and improve the website's rating. A quick increase in this measure can make it easier to rise to the top of search engine results pages. • Links: • Links are a fundamental component of Google's ranking system. Links pointing to a website, both in number and caliber, serve as trust signals. Rankings are greatly impacted by high-quality, naturally acquired links; low-quality, spammy links might result in penalties.

  3. Site Layout Google looks at a website's design, taking into account things like page loading speed and mobile friendliness. Pages containing an excessive amount of advertising, particularly above the fold, may be demoted. Maintaining or raising ranks by making sure a simple, easy-to-use design complies with Google's standards. The Ranking Page's age: A webpage's ranking is affected by its age, especially for competitive keywords. Because it believes older pages have more pertinent content, Google tends to trust them. According to a study conducted by Ahrefs, the average age of websites that rank highly is two years or more, highlighting the significance of longevity in the digital sphere. Domain Authority: Another important component is domain authority, which indicates a website's legitimacy in a certain industry. Gaining a high ranking may take longer, especially for competitive keywords, even though some improvement might be seen in a few weeks. Keeping an eye on this statistic will reveal how successful your SEO campaigns are. Competition: A major factor affecting ranking timelines is the competitive landscape. It is essential to identify competitors, examine their keyword ranks, and comprehend their SEO tactics. Strategically navigating the competitive landscape is made possible by designing your plan based on their strengths and limitations.
